Abstract
Commenting on the poetry of Carlos Germán Belli, a key writer in contemporary Spanish-American poetry, the present article focuses on analyzing a set of representations that allude both to the structure of society and to the production of a functional subject for that society. The article studies the representation of diverse mechanisms of social domination but, at the same time, it highlights the spaces of resistance. Finally, it observes how his poetry offers intense (and very tense) dynamics of power and liberation, control and utopia.
